Brittany Nicole Huffman's Obituary

Brittany Nicole Huffman, 26, passed away on Monday, February 24, 2020 in Ormond Beach, Florida.  She was born on February 9, 1994 to Bill and Andrea Huffman, née Taylor, at Saint Joseph Hospital in Augusta, Georgia. Brittany grew up a spunky and upbeat child, always the star of the show.  She successfully competed in beauty and talent pageants during her adolescent years.  In high school, she became a cheerleader, a trait she would carry throughout her life.  Brittany graduated from Calvary Christian Academy in 2012 and went on to enroll in Daytona State College where she earned her associate degree in surgical technology. Brittany enjoyed making people laugh, playing with her dachshund, Champ, and applying other people's makeup to make them feel and look their very best.  She was known by her family and friends for her goodwill to all people, her giving nature, and her ability to sense when people needed her help.  She had a loving and cheerful personality that brightened any room.  Anyone who knew her would tell you that she was one of the most caring people they ever met.  She always made sure that the people in her life were cared for and she always stood up for the people she loved.  You certainly don't meet a person like her every day.  She was loved by so many and made an impact on numerous lives. She is survived by her parents, Bill and Andrea Huffman; four siblings: sister, Sara Huffman; brother and sister-in law, Russell and Priska Jordan; brother, William Huffman; sister, Tori Huffman; grandparents, Danny "Papa" and Darnell "Grandma" Taylor of North Augusta, South Carolina; grandmother, Shirley "Nonnie" McIntosh of Aiken, South Carolina; grandmother, Grace Huffman of Warrenville, South Carolina; great-grandmother, Myrtle "Granny" Clary of Keystone Heights, Florida; as well as many loving aunts, uncles, cousins, other relatives and friends. She was preceded in death by great-grandparents, Jacob and Mildred "Grammy" Taylor; great-grandparents, Henry and Lorene McIntosh; and great-grandfather Edward Clary. Brittany's family and friends will celebrate her life on Sunday, March 1, 2020 at Lohman Funeral Home, 733 West Granada Boulevard, Ormond Beach, Florida.  The visitation will take place from 12 PM – 2 PM with the funeral service immediately following at 2 PM.  Mark Spivey, MA, LCSW will officiate.
